تأمین بهینه منابع کاربریهای تجارت الکترونیک در شبکه...
DESCRIPTION
تأمین بهینه منابع کاربریهای تجارت الکترونیک در شبکه های نسل آینده. استاد راهنما : آقاي دكتر عباس آسوشه ليلي پورجواهري. فهرست مقدمه اي بر شبكه هاي نسل جديد وكيفيت سرويس كيفيت سرويس در تجارت الكترونيك TPC-W معياري براي ارزيابي اجرايي تجارت الكترونيك - PowerPoint PPT PresentationTRANSCRIPT
استاد راهنما : آقاي دكتر عباس آسوشه
ليلي پورجواهري
تأمین بهینه منابع کاربریهای تجارت الکترونیک در شبکه های نسل آینده
of 322
فهرست
وكيفيت مقدمه اي بر شبكه هاي نسل جديد•
سرويس
كيفيت سرويس در تجارت الكترونيك•
•TPC-W معياري براي ارزيابي اجرايي تجارت
الكترونيك
بررسي چگونگي تأثير پارامترهاي مؤثر بر •
روي ظرفيت منابع
نتيجه و كارهاي آينده•
مخابراتی های شبکهسنتی
بودن سرویس تک(صوت)
کیفیت امکان عدمسرویس
3 of 32
شبكه هاي نسل جديد
اضافه شدن كيفيت سرويس انتها به انتها به شبكه هاي مبتني بر
بسته امروزي
جدايي اليه سرويس از انتقال
Voice
TDM
Data
ATM
E-Com
TDM
VPN
FR
...Session mgmt,
Connection mgmt,
SignalingControl
Switching
Resourcemgmt
Connectionmgmt
SignalingControl
Switching
SecurityResource
mgmtControlRouting
Switching
Resourcemgmt
Connectionmgmt
SignalingControl
Switching
TodaySingle-Service Networks
4 of 32
Next Generation Network
Access Access
Signaling and Control
Switching and Routing
Transport
Services and Applications
Next Generation Multi-service
Network
TDM Network (PSTN/ISDNLLNet, etc.)
كيفيت سرويسجهت الزم تكنيكه�اي مجموع�ه س�رويس كيفيت ت�أخير، لغ�زش و گم ش�دن ، بان�د پهن�اي م�ديريت بس�ته ه�ا ، بمنظ�ور ارائ�ه س�رويس ب�ا كيفيت م�ورد
توافق به كاربر، ميباشد.
ب�ه كيفيت س�رويس دسترس�ي تج�اري دي�دگاه از م�ورد كاربرده�اي توس�ط ش�بكه در الزم من�ابع را ، ش�بكه ت�رافيكي ب�ار تغي�ير عل�يرغم نظ�ر،
تضمين مينمايد.
6 of 32
پاسخ زمان
داده
پیام
ثبات
یکپارچگی داده
هزینه
ثبات روش
ستحکاام
ظرفیت
میانکاری
یکپارچگی
اقتصاد
ویژگیQoS ثبات
واصل
امنیت
قابلیت اعتماد
دسترس پذیری
اجرا
تأخیر
گذردهی
MTTR
تعادل بار
Up Time
MTBF
بازیافتنی
پایداری
پیغام رسان
یاحراز هویت
رمزنگاری
قابلیتبازبین
ی
عدم انکار
عملکرد
ناموفق
حادثه
6 of 32
7 of 32
سرویس کیفیت
فیزیکی الیه
شبکه الیه
الیه کاربرد
8 of 32
تجارت الکترونیک
تعامالت مربوط به خرید وفروش کاالها و یا سرویسها که این تعامالت بصورت الکترونیکی بین طرفین و از طریق محیطی باز مانند اینترنت انجام میپذیرد.
نیازها به پاسخگوئیهزينه کمترین صرفنرم و افزاری سخت
افزاری
9 of 32
گذردهی میزان
مصرفی منابع پاسخ زمان
نشست زمان نشست مدت بودن دسترس در
در مؤثر معیارهایسرویس کیفیت تأمین
الکترونیک درتجارتهای
10 of 32
شبیه سازی یک تجارت الکترونیکی بر اساس یک معیار خاص
TPC-Wیک سری مشخصات استاندارد جهت ارزیابی اجرای پردازشهای
تعاملی تجاری
11 of 32
سرور كاربرد
سرور http
ذخيره web
شبيه ساز
جستجوگNر
شبيه ساز
دروازه پرداخت
شبيه ساز
جستجوگ1ر
سرور ديتابيس
شبكه
ر
ت مال
تعا
دهاربر
كا
واسط
بخش سرور تجارت الكترونيك
بخش كاربران
of 3212
PIII 667
256 MB RAM40 GB HDD
PIII 667
256 MB RAM40 GB HDD
PIII 667
256 MB RAM 40 GB HDD
PIII 667
256 MB RAM10 GB HDD
Database server Web server Application server
Workstation
100 Mbps switched HUB
#Name Description Type
1ADMC-تأیید مجریAdmin confirmسفارش
2ADMR-درخواست مجریAdmin request
سفارش
3BESS-بهترین فروشندهBest sellerجستجو
4BUYC-تأیید خریدBuy confirmسفارش
5BUYR-درخواست خریدBuy request
سفارش
6CREG-ثبت مشتریCustomer registration
سفارش
7HOME-صفحه اصلیHome جستجو
8NEWP-محصول جدیدNew productجستجو
9ORDD -نمایش سفارش Order display
سفارش
10ORDI-پرس و جوی سفارشOrder inquiry
سفارش
11PROD-جزئیات محصولProduct detail
جستجو
12SREQ-درخواست جستجوSearch request
جستجو
13SRES-نتایج جستجوsearch results
جستجو
14SHOP-کارت خریدShopping cartسفارش
13 of 32
14 of 32
p1,7 = 0.9952, p1,12 = 0.0047
p2,1 = 0.8999, p2,7 = 0.1000
p3,7 = 0.0167, p3,11 = 0.0305, p3,12 = 0.9455, p3,14 = 0.0072
p4,7 = 0.0084, p4,12 = 0.9915
p5,4 = 0.4614, p5,7 = 0.1932, p5,14 = 0.3453
p6,5 = 0.8666, p6,7 = 0.0094, p6,12 = 0.1239
p7,3 = 0.3124, p7,8 = 0.3125, p7,10 = 0.0469, p7,12 = 0.0808,p7,14 = 0.2973
p8,7 = 0.0156, p8,11 = 0.9579, p8,10 = 0.0049, p8,14 = 0.0215
p9,7 = 0.0690, p9,10 = 0.9930
p10,7 = 0.0720, p10,9 = 0.8800, p10,12 = 0.1127
p11,2 = 0.0058, p11,7 = 0.0774, p11,11 = 0.0456, p11,12 = 0.7315,
p11,14 = 0.1396
p12,7 = 0.0635, p12,13 = 0.8500, p12,14 = 0.0864
p13,7 = 0.2657, p13,11 = 0.6637, p13,12 = 0.0010, p13,14 = 0.0695
p14,6 = 0.2585, p14,7 = 0.6967, p14,14 = 0.0447
15 of 32
انواع تعامالت در TPC-W
WIPS(Web Interaction Per Second) خرید
-WIPSجستجوb
WIPS-o سفارش
16 of 32
17 of 32
7:HOME12:SRE
Q
9:ORDD
10:ORDI
5:BUYR
4:BUYC
6:CREG
11:PROD
14:SHOP
2:ADMR
8:NEWP
13:SRES
3:BESS
1:ADMC
18 of 32
2:ADMR
13:SRES
1:ADMC
of 3219
وب سرورسروركاربرد سرور
ديتابيس
سطح كاربر سطح ارائه سطح تجاري سطح ديتابيس
منابع بهینه تآمین شبکه
تخمین صحیح تعداد سرورهای مورد نیاز از هر
نوع جهت پاسخگوئی به حجم تعامالت
تخمین صحیح تعداد پردازشگرها و حافظه های بکار رفته در هر سرور
جهت ایجاد ظرفیت مناسب
20 of 32
پاسخ زمان گرفتن نظر در بدون درخواست نوع هر گذردهی میزان
N =[T /C P]
پاسخ زمان گرفتن نظر در با درخواست نوع هر گذردهی میزان
سطح هر به مربوط گذردهی
تایر : هر نیاز Cظرفیت مورد سرورهای تعداد
سرور ظرفيت
21 of 32
Cp هnت کnامالتی اسnداد تعnرور تعnرفیت سnان ظnا همnی رسnیدگی آنهnا بnه ثانیnه هnر در میتوانnد سnرور هnر
نماید.
CP=C/B
C تعداد تعامالت کامل شده در مدت زمان :مشاهده
B مدت زمان اشغال بودن سرور :
مدت زمnانی کnه هnر سnرور صnرف رسnیدگی بnه حجم میکنnد تجnاری تعnامالت از عوامnل )B(مشخصnی بnه ،
متعnددی بسnتگی دارد.از جملnه مهمnترین این عوامnل بکnار گرفتnه تعnداد پردازشnگرها و مقnدار حافظnه
شده میباشد.
22 of 32
B .مدت زمانی که سرور در حال فعالیت می باشد: Tمدت زمان مشاهده : Cتعداد تعامالت کامل شده در مدت زمان مشاهده : Sمتوسط مدت زمان الزم برای تکمیل یک تعامل : WIPSمتوسط تعداد تعامالت تکمیل شده در یک بازه زمانی مشخص :
CPظرفیت سیستم : Qمتوسط تعداد تعامالت در صف :
Rمتوسط مدت زمان الزم جهت پاسخ به تعامل : CPU(U)=U درصدی از ظرفیت : CPU.که در یک بازه زمانی مصرف میشود
CPU(N) تعداد : CPUهای یک سرور EBتعداد کاربران :
RAM مقدار متوسط : RAM23 بکار رفته در هر سرور of 32
of 3224
چگونگي تأثير تعداد پردازشگرها بر ظرفيت سرور
چگونگي تأثير حافظه بر ظرفيت سرور
چگونگي تأثير تعداد جستجو گرها بر حجم تعامالت
قابل پردازش
چگونگي تأثير تعداد جستجو گرها بر مدت زمان
پاسخ
مطالب مورد بحث در ادامه
CP=C/B
S=B/CR=Q(S+
1)
CPU(U)=B/T
Number ofCPU
25 of 32
چگونگي تأثير تعداد پردازشگرها بر ظرفيت سرور
26 of 32
˹
%̋
˺ ˹
˺%
˻ ˹
˻%
˼ ˹
˺ ˻ ˼ )̋
ÄÌ¿Zi
{cÔ»Z e
�
ZÅ´ Y{ a{Y| e� � � �
˺ ˻* Mbytes
˻%+ Mbytes
%̋ ˺ ˻ Mbytes
˺% ˼+ Mbytes
˺% ˼+ Mbytes wiyhout PGE
27 of 32
ميزان تأثيرتعداد پردازشگرها بر روي تعامالت
EB/14 < WIPS < EB/7
EB
CPUUTILIZATIO
N
BUSY
TIME
S
28 of 32
چگونگي تأثير تعداد جستجو گرها بر حجم تعامالت پردازش شده
WIPS
˹ ˹ ˹
˻ ˹ ˹
)̋ ˹ ˹
+̋ ˹ ˹
*̋˹ ˹
˺ ˹ ˹ ˹
˹ ˹ ˹ ˻ ˹ ˹ ˹ )̋ ˹ ˹ ˹ +̋ ˹ ˹ ˹
ÄÌ¿Zi
{cÔ»
Z e�
ZųÂnf m� �(EB)
EB/ ,̋
EB/˺)
Main
29 of 32
ميزان تأثيرتعداد جستجوگرها بر روي تعامالت
EB
S U=B/T Q=U/I-U
30 of 32
چگونگي تأثير تعداد جستجو گرها بر مدت زمان پاسخ
R=Q(S+1)
˹
˺ ˹
˻ ˹
˼ ˹
)̋ ˹
%̋ ˹
+̋ ˹
,̋˹
*̋˹
%̋ ˹ ˺ ˹ ˹ ˺% ˹ ˻ ˹ ˹
xZa½
Z»�
�ÄÌ
¿ZiÊ
Ì̧»
½ZËf »{Y| e� �
پروفايل جستجو
˹
˻ ˹
)̋ ˹
+̋ ˹
*̋˹
˺ ˹ ˹
%̋ ˹ ˺ ˹ ˹ ˺% ˹ ˻ ˹ ˹
xZa½
Z»�
�ÄÌ¿
ZiÊÌ̧»
½ZËf »{Y| e� �
پروفايل سفارش
31 of 32
تخمین منابع با استفاده از روشهای کم�ی و بر اساس پارامترهای اجرایی
گذردهی پاسخ میزان زمان
اشباع نقطه
ارتباط بین تعداد پردازشگرها و حافظه بکار گرفته شده در باال بردن ظرفیت سیستم
تأثير تعداد و نوع كاربران بر روي زمان پاسخ و در نتيجه ظرفيت سيستم
استخراج الگوي ریاضی حاکم بر تأثیرات پارامترهای مؤثر بر روی ظرفیت منابع مورد نياز در تجارت
الكترونيك به منظور کنترل و مدیریت کیفیت سرويس
32 of 32